Transaction 7649980a101d405e277e9f01610fa525e5bcac846f0b605df7139be984e8f76e

2 Input
1 Outputs
  • 7649980a101d405e277e9f01610fa525e5bcac846f0b605df7139be984e8f76e:0
  • value  509994613
    address  36W5ijcg8s6cAxYyuF8JQwi6tfQwR8N2uf